1. Reliability and Efficiency: The Heart of the Cruze
The 2013 Chevrolet Cruze 1.6 Manual isn’t just about saving money upfront – it’s about saving on the long haul. Equipped with a 1.6-liter four-cylinder engine, this car delivers a solid 138 horsepower and 128 lb-ft of torque, making it surprisingly peppy for a compact vehicle. The manual transmission adds to the driving experience, allowing you to control the power exactly how you want it. Plus, with an EPA-estimated 27 mpg in the city and 37 mpg on the highway, you’re not just driving a car; you’re driving a statement about efficiency. 📈

3. Safety Features and Value for Money
For a car in its price range, the 2013 Chevrolet Cruze 1.6 Manual packs quite a punch when it comes to safety features. Standard equipment includes anti-lock brakes, stability control, and multiple airbags. Optional packages can add features like rearview cameras and OnStar, which can be lifesavers in emergencies.
